september 11, 2026 - tom hollis
Tom Hollis is a retired psychologist. He received his master’s degree from the University of Dayton and his doctoral degree from the University of Tennessee where he was trained at the University Counseling Center. His career included the community mental health center in Savannah, both full time and part time for 16 years. He was in a private practice group, Savannah Psychotherapy Center, for 34 years where he specialized in individual and couples counseling. Tom will be giving a presentation titled "Sleep: How to get enough, and why it's important."
september 18, 2026 - jessica leigh lebos 
Jessica Leigh Lebos writes about interesting people, enchanting places, and the compelling—and often confounding—connections in between. She is the author of two books, Savannah Sideways and The Camellia Thief & Other Tales, as well as The Savannah Sideways Podcast, a 10-episode history-mystery that unravels one of the city's strangest stories. She has received multiple awards from the National Society of Newspaper Columnists and introduces herself at cocktail parties as "Southern by marriage."
